2003 Citroen C3 vs. 2007 Jeep Grand Cherokee
To start off, 2007 Jeep Grand Cherokee is newer by 4 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2003 Citroen C3.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2003 Citroen C3 would be higher. At 4,701 cc (8 cylinders), 2007 Jeep Grand Cherokee is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Jeep Grand Cherokee (235 HP @ 4500 RPM) has 176 more horse power than 2003 Citroen C3. (59 HP @ 5500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2007 Jeep Grand Cherokee should accelerate faster than 2003 Citroen C3.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2007 Jeep Grand Cherokee weights approximately 627 kg more than 2003 Citroen C3.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Because 2007 Jeep Grand Cherokee is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2003 Citroen C3.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2007 Jeep Grand Cherokee will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2007 Jeep Grand Cherokee (414 Nm @ 3600 RPM) has 303 more torque (in Nm) than 2003 Citroen C3. (111 Nm @ 3200 RPM). This means 2007 Jeep Grand Cherokee will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2003 Citroen C3. 2007 Jeep Grand Cherokee has automatic transmission and 2003 Citroen C3 has manual transmission. 2003 Citroen C3 will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2007 Jeep Grand Cherokee will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
Compare all specifications:
2003 Citroen C3 | 2007 Jeep Grand Cherokee | |
Make | Citroen | Jeep |
Model | C3 | Grand Cherokee |
Year Released | 2003 | 2007 |
Body Type | Hatchback | SUV |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1124 cc | 4701 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 8 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| V |
Valves per Cylinder | 2 valves | 2 valves |
Horse Power | 59 HP | 235 HP |
Engine RPM | 5500 RPM | 4500 RPM |
Torque | 111 Nm | 414 Nm |
Torque RPM | 3200 RPM | 3600 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 72 mm | 93 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 69 mm | 86.7 mm |
Fuel Type | Gasoline - Premium | Gasoline - Premium |
Drive Type | Front | 4WD |
Transmission Type | Manual | Automatic |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 5 doors | 5 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 1053 kg | 1680 kg |
Vehicle Length | 3860 mm | 4750 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1670 mm | 1870 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1540 mm | 1730 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2410 mm | 2790 mm |
Fuel Consumption Overall | 6.2 L/100km | 13.8 L/100km |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 45 L | 80 L |
